posticously

From Wiktionary, the free dictionary

Remove ads

English

Etymology

From posticous + -ly.

Adverb

posticously (comparative more posticously, superlative most posticously)

  1. (chiefly botany) Posteriorly.
  2. (botany, not comparable) In a manner with which, or a phytological conformation within which a physical aspect, especially the extrorse anther, is situated on the outer side of a filament.
